Job Description

SUMMARY• Under indirect supervision, provides and manages access to local medical care in the area of operation,• providing support to RMI Global Coordination Centre (GCC) in the security and receipt of payments to third• party medical establishments. Acts as the RMI representative for all operational and pastoral requirements of patients under the care of RMI.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ES include but are not limited to the following:

  • Remain available throughout agreed hours of coverage for contact by the RMI GCC
  • Deploy to pre-defined medical facilities in area of operation to meet and greet RMI patient within 1 hour of notification from GCC (Or any other agreed timeframes).
  • Work in conjunction with the GCC to ensure that payment methods have been agreed with the receiving medical facility. Where applicable, act as a mediator between medical facility and GCC.
  • Ensure swift access to care for RMI patients, responding to problems in a pragmatic and professional manner to resolve as quickly as possible.
  • Provide translation from local dialect to English in both verbal and written forms and pass this on to thee GCC.
  • Deploy to medical facilities daily when a protracted in-patient stay occurs.
  • Manage the welfare of patients through any admission to a medical facility, ensuring that the patient is comfortable, understands the treatment being provided and meet reasonable requests for support.
  • Establish working relationships with treating physicians and where applicable speak directly with the treating medical team to acquire up to date information.
  • Provide timely updates to the GCC on the status and proposed plans for the patient in both written and verbal forms.
  • Always demonstrate a professional and calm persona, with a confident ability to liaise with client management as required.
  • Utilize local knowledge to arrange other services, as required

EDUCATION and EXPERIENCE:

  • Minimum of 2 years’ experience as a medical healthcare professional in area of operation.
  • Bilingual – local language & dialect (as per area of operation), and English.
  • Experience providing patient advocacy in remote/international areas, preferred.
  • Foreign travel experience.
  • Excellent communication skills and professionalism.
  • Demonstrated self-discipline.
  • Ability to integrate into a cross-culturalsocialstructure.

COMPUTER SKILLS:

  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office applications, and general computer & technology literacy preferred.

CERTIFICATES AND LICENSES:

  • Valid driver’s license for area of operation (preferred)
